    Senior Quality Assurance Analyst

    Job Purpose and Background The client is looking for a capable Senior Quality Assurance Analyst who will be responsible for delivering high quality in software testing and assurance for Client's software to internal and external users, with a focus on early identification of issues to minimise impact on the end user. They will work primarily as part of the DevOps team supporting digitally enabled products and services but will also support the wider application set as required, particularly Disclosure which is our main business process. About The Technology Team Dependable, efficient, innovative, and effective technology services are critical to the core function of Clients and enabling it to deliver its core mission. As part of its strategic ambitions Client has recognised an uplift to technology operations and capabilities is critical to realise its strategic goals of higher impact, improved stakeholder experience and disclosure information. Therefore, we are strengthening the technology function to provide a clear vision and roadmap of the technology landscape, to improve our relationship to key internal and external stakeholders and to build the technology capabilities needed to deliver outcomes, while providing a resilient, stable, secure, and cost-effective IT service. Key responsibilities include:
    • Experience in building test automation frameworks from scratch
    • Proficient at creating, maintaining, and developing test scripts both front end and backend systems (GUI's, Flat file transfer, API's, Databases etc)
    • Improving the quality of the software delivered to users
    • Developing test strategies, test plans, techniques and manage all testing efforts within BAU function and new project developments
    • Produce test scripts and regression suites for new and amended software
    • Responsible for test planning and execution of system related tests including integration,
    • regression tests
    • Establish procedures for results analysis and reporting
    • Design and implement defect tracking and correction procedures with use of best practices and test tools available
    • Planning and carrying out system testing of software, including verifying once its delivered to production, whilst working with end users to understand requirements and acceptance criteria and translate them into high level and low level test scenarios and cases
    • Supporting user acceptance testing with data preparation and test case creation tasks
    • Responsibility for covering the Senior Quality Assurance Manager if off sick and on leave
    • Ability to drive testing phases from start to end by leading small test teams including
    • business users
    • Able to plan, schedule and monitor work to meet tight deadlines and quality targets
    • Apply the appropriate test measurements and metrics
    • They will need to develop and maintain technical/ project QA documentation
    Requirements
    • Required skills and experience:
    • Expert knowledge and experience of, but not limited to: o Manual testing
    • Automation Testing - Selenium web driver, API testing, postman, GUI
    • Familiar and adhere to TDD & BDD approaches and best practices
    • Test Management Tools - ALM, JIRA, X-Ray, Azure DevOps or similar tool set
    • Minimum of 3-5 years' experience in software testing with use of both automation and manual testing ISTQB Foundation in Software Testing Certification
    • Bachelor's degree in IT, Engineering, Computer Science or related field or equivalence years of experience in the IT domain
    • Proven experience in architecting, implemented and maintaining automation frameworks
    • Experience of planning and executing tests on web applications and MS Dynamics CRM
    • The ability to investigate and trouble-shoot a wide range of technical problems
    • Has a process orientated and systematic approach to planning and problem solving through consistent approach with high expectations of quality and integrity
    • The person will need to be Committed, self-starter, quick learner, results driven, self-reflective team player versatile with open mind when learning new technologies and tools
    • Maintains an awareness of developing best practices and takes responsibility for driving their own development
    • Stakeholder engagement, able to build relationships and use expertise to influence and help your colleagues use tools to achieve their outcomes
    • Excellent communication, verbal and knowledge skills in problem analysis, risk management and continual improvement
    • Desired skills and experience (optional)
    • Has a thorough understanding of testing best practices such as Agile (Scrum) or DevOps methodologies
    • ITIL process understanding
    • Exposure in Climate change data legislation, practices, and stakeholders
    • Experience in environmental related industries i.e., Water, energy, forestry related
    • Experiencing using SQL, oracle and similar database technologies running queries would be beneficial
    • This is a full-time based at Clients London office reporting to the Senior Quality Assurance & Change Manager, Technology & Operations
